About This Event

This neighborhood Tanabata festival takes place on the Sumadera-mae Shopping Street, which leads to the ancient Sumadera Temple of Genpei-war fame in Kobe's Suma Ward. A large bamboo is set up where visitors tie wish cards. From the evening, stalls run by shop-street volunteers offer old-fashioned festival games such as goldfish scooping, superball scooping, and yo-yo fishing, drawing yukata-clad children and families. With its retro temple-town charm and handmade feel, it is a long-cherished local summer tradition that pairs well with a visit to Sumadera.
